Comentario del broker
Built for C Thomas Clagett Jr, an American businessman in 1976, this 72' ketch has had a fascinating history! Built at Derecktor Shipyard (known as America's most accomplished boatbuilder), her early life was spent around Florida and the Bahamas where having a centreboard made cruising that area accessible for a large yacht.
She came across the Atlantic and made her way to the Isle of Wight. Her last outing was in 2020 when she sailed across the channel. She is now afloat and does need to be moved from the marina on sale completion.
There is a lot of boat here, she has huge liveaboard potential, albeit there is plenty of work to be done but she appears solid and certainly sits afloat happily. The yard have had the engine running and the majority of her equipment tested over the last few months and gradually we are finding out more information which will be added to the listing. Historic paperwork is limited but what we have can be sent on request.
